Abstract

Official abstract text for this publication.

Disclosed herein are compositions, which can be used to coat electrode plates, comprising at least one carbonaceous material and at least one additive, wherein the at least one additive comprises a metal ion selected from calcium, barium, potassium, magnesium, and strontium ion, and wherein the metal ion is present in an amount ranging from 0.5 wt. % to 3 wt. % relative to the total weight of carbonaceous material. Also disclosed are electrodes and lead acid batteries comprising such compositions, and methods of making the compositions.

The invention claimed is: 1. A composition comprising at least one carbonaceous material and at least one metal lignosulfonate, wherein the at least one metal lignosulfonate is selected from calcium, barium, potassium, magnesium, and strontium lignosulfonates, and the metal ion of the at least one metal lignosulfonate is present in an amount ranging from 0.5 wt. % to 3 wt. % relative to the total weight of the at least one carbonaceous material. 2. The composition of claim 1 , wherein the composition comprises composite particles comprising the at least one carbonaceous material and the at least one metal lignosulfonate. 3. The composition of claim 1 , wherein the composition is in the form of a powder or a pellet. 4. The composition of claim 1 , wherein the at least one carbonaceous material is interspersed with the at least one metal lignosulfonate. 5. The composition of claim 1 , wherein the at least one metal lignosulfonate comprises calcium lignosulfonate. 6. The composition of claim 1 , further comprising at least one lead-containing material. 7. The composition of claim 6 , wherein the lead-containing material is selected from lead, PbO, leady oxide, Pb 3 O 4 , Pb 2 O, and Pb SO 4 , hydroxides, acids, and metal complexes thereof. 8. The composition of claim 1 , further comprising at least one organic molecule expander that is different from the at least one metal lignosulfonate. 9. The composition of claim 1 , further comprising BaSO 4 . 10. An electrode comprising an electrode plate coated with the composition claim 1 . 11. A lead acid battery comprising the electrode of claim 10 . 12. The composition of claim 1 , wherein the composition comprises the at least one carbonaceous material present in an amount ranging from 40% to 45% by weight, relative to the total weight of the composition. 13. The composition of claim 1 , wherein the at least one metal lignosulfonate is present in an amount ranging from 5-10% by weight, relative to the total weight of the composition. 14. The composition of claim 1 , further comprising water in an amount ranging from 45-55% by weight, relative to the total weight of the composition.
